First Buddhist Primary School Opens in Uganda

The Uganda Buddhist Centre, led by the first Ugandan-born Buddhist monk Venerable Bhante Bhikku Ugandawe Buddharakkitha, has announced the official opening of the nation’s first Buddhist primary school.

“[This will be a school] where people learn to train their hands, to train their heads, and also to train their hearts through meditation,”said Ven. Bhante Buddharakkhita. (YouTube)

“At the moment, 24 children are enrolled in our Kindergarten Program, aka Peace School, the Uganda Buddhist Centre shared. “The kids range from 3–5 years old and are from the surrounding area called Bulega. We are funding three full-time teachers and two staff members to cater for everyone and maintain the classrooms.” (Uganda Buddhist Centre)
